Properties

GB / England / London / Greater London / Westminster / Harrow Road / Lapford Close

Average
UnitNameBedroomsBathroomsFeaturesPriceSqftLast sale
3100£ 435,40002022-08-09T23:00:00Z
1 / 1 (1)